OBJECTIVE: The aim of this study was to evaluate the role of cytology in providing a reliable diagnosis upon which the clinician can base further investigative or treatment strategies in patients with laryngeal and pharyngeal tumours. METHODS: Imprint cytology diagnoses from 174 patients were correlated with the histological result of a corresponding biopsy. RESULTS: We found that the imprint cytology proved to be a useful, quick and reliable method with complete diagnostic accuracy, sensitivity, specificity, positive predictive value and negative predictive values of 97%, 96%, 100%, 100% and 92% respectively. CONCLUSION: Imprint cytology allows diagnostic statements in a shorter time than is possible with histological sections and proves a useful adjunct in evaluating laryngeal and pharyngeal lesions. The validity of the method depends on the care with which the specimen is sampled and on the experience of the investigator.  相似文献

Nielsen JM 《Theriogenology》2005,64(3):510-518
The objective of this study was to compare results from endometrial culture swabs with results from culturing of endometrial biopsies. The culture results were related to cytological findings (polymorphonuclear; PMN-cells) and histological observations (PMN-cells). Biopsy and swab samples were smeared on the surface of a blood agar petri dish, and examined for growth of bacteria. Cytology samples were obtained from endometrial biopsies, stained and examined under microscopy for the presence of PMN-cells. Endometrial biopsies were examined for the presence of PMN-infiltration of the endometrial luminal epithelium and the stratum compactum. Using the presence of PMNs in a tissue specimen as the "best standard" for diagnosing endometritis, the sensitivity of bacterial growth from an endometrial biopsy was 0.82. The sensitivity for cytology was 0.77, and the sensitivity of bacterial growth from an endometrial surface swab was 0.34. The specificity for biopsy cultures, swab cultures, and cytology to diagnose endometritis were 0.92, 1.0, and 1.0 respectively. The positive predictive value for biopsy cultures, swab cultures, and cytology were 0.97, 1.0, and 1.0 respectively. The negative predictive value for biopsy cultures, swab cultures, and cytology were 0.67, 0.44, and 0.62 respectively. In conclusion, bacteriological culture and cytology from an endometrial biopsy provide the practitioner with the most accurate results regarding both sensitivity and positive predictive value.  相似文献

A 3-year study assessed the diagnostic accuracy of touch imprint smears in the diagnosis of lung cancer. Touch imprint smears were prepared from 90 computerized tomographic-guided core needle lung biopsies. Cytological diagnosis of touch imprint smears were correlated with the histological diagnosis of the corresponding core needle biopsy specimen, which was taken as the gold standard. The sensitivity, specificity, positive predictive value and negative predictive value of imprint smear results were 89%, 100%, 100% and 68%, respectively. There were no false positives, and all patients with small cell lung cancer were correctly diagnosed with this technique. Imprint cytology can be used to provide a rapid, preliminary diagnosis of lung cancer.  相似文献

OBJECTIVE: To determine efficacy and utility of NMP-22 in follow-up of bladder urothelial carcinoma (UC) and compare NMP-22 as a single evaluating test vs combination with cytology. STUDY DESIGN: Ninety-four consecutive urine cytology samples of bladder UC were identified. Patients received follow-up urine cytology, NMP-22 testing and cystoscopy with surgical biopsy. RESULTS: NMP-22 specificity was 100%, sensitivity 45%, positive predictive value (PPV) 100% and negative predictive value (NPV) 87%. NMP-22 showed lower sensitivity for high-grade lesions and higher for low-grade lesions. Cytologic diagnosis had a high inconclusive rate; when regarded as positive, it resulted in 75% sensitivity, 58% specificity, 33% PPV and 89% NPV. NMP-22 correctly classified 60% of false negative cases diagnosed by cytology with low-grade UC and clarified 27 inconclusive cytologic diagnoses. NMP-22 misclassified 9 cases as false negative, all with high-grade UC; all were correctly identified on cytology as true positive. Combined interpretation showed 90% sensitivity, 92% specificity, 75% PPV and 98% NPV. CONCLUSION: NMP-22 complements cytology by its higher sensitivity for low-grade lesions; its values are not affected by bacillus Calmette Guérin therapy changes, which are limiting in cytology. Combined interpretation of NMP-22 and cytology shows promise as an effective, noninvasive method for surveillance of UC.  相似文献

目的:探讨尿液外泌小体(exosomes)中微小RNA(miRNA,miR)的变化与肾纤维化的关系,以寻找早期诊断肾纤维化的生物标志物。方法:以行肾穿刺活检术并诊断为原发性肾脏病的患者为研究对象,其中,肾活检未发现肾纤维化的患者作为对照组,而存在轻到中度肾纤维化的患者作为纤维化组。收集20 m L晨尿,用超速离心方法分离尿液exosomes,用电镜观察其形态,用定量PCR方法检测其中miRNA的含量,并分析其与肾纤维化的关系。结果:超速离心获得的尿液沉淀物呈现exosomes的形态学特征。miR-21、miR-29b、miR-29c、miR-30e、miR-192、miR-200a、miR-200c和miR-429可在所有患者的尿液exosomes中被检出,但含量存在较大差异。与对照组相比,纤维化组患者尿液exosomes中,miR-21、miR-29b、miR-30e和miR-200c的含量显著增高,miR-29c的含量显著下降,而miR-192、miR-200a和miR-429的含量无显著变化。尿液exosomes中miRNA含量与纤维化肾组织中miRNA表达量的变化并不完全一致。结论:尿液exosomes中miR-29c和miR-21的含量在肾纤维化的病变中发生显著改变,可能成为早期诊断肾纤维化的生物标志物。  相似文献

OBJECTIVE: To investigate the morphologic characteristics and immunocytochemical reaction to vimentin of the reactive renal tubular cells (RRTCs) in renal glomerular disease. STUDY DESIGN: We prospectively evaluated the urine cytology of renal glomerular disease in 40 patients who underwent renal biopsy. The cytology and renal biopsy specimens were analyzed for vimentin immunostaining. RESULTS: A total of 40 urine samples from the 40 patients were cytologically analyzed, and RRTCs were found in 25 samples (25 of 40, 62.5%). These RRTCs showed clear or vacuolated cytoplasm, intracytoplasmic pigmented granules (hemosiderin or lipofuscin) and large nuclei with round to irregular nuclear contours and prominent nucleoli. These cells were seen singly and in acinar clusters. Occasionally RRTCs were embedded in a cast (RRTC cast). Immunocytochemicalstudy revealed RRTCs to be positive for vimentin (25 of 25, 100%). CONCLUSION: Frequently observed characteristic cytomorphologic features of RRTCs included RRTC cast, acinar cluster, vacuolated cytoplasm and intracytoplasmic pigmented granules. A diagnosis of RRTCs can be suggested based on these cytomorphologic features. However, a definitive diagnosis will require immunocytochemical confirmation for vimentin.  相似文献

Michael Diagnostic value of fine needle aspirates processed by ThinPrep® for the assessment of axillary lymph node status in patients with invasive carcinoma of the breast Objective: To evaluate the utility of ThinPrep® as an optional specimen processing method for the detection of axillary lymph node metastasis of invasive breast carcinoma. Methods: A computer SNOMED search from the file at our institution between January 2003 and August 2011 retrieved a total of 209 fine needle aspiration (FNA) specimens of axillary lymph nodes prepared by ThinPrep and followed by axillary lymph node biopsy and/or dissection. Original cytological diagnoses and corresponding histological diagnoses were documented. Using the histological diagnoses as the gold standard, the diagnostic parameters including sensitivity, specificity, positive (PPV) and negative predictive values (NPV) and diagnostic accuracy were calculated. Both cytology and histology slides from cyto‐histologically discrepant cases were reviewed. Results: Out of a total of 209 specimens, 193 (92%) had adequate diagnostic material while the remaining 16 specimens (8%) were inadequate for cytological assessment. The diagnostic specimens included 168 invasive ductal carcinomas (IDC), 15 invasive lobular carcinomas (ILC) and 10 mixed carcinomas (IDC and ILC). Excluding 19 cases with malignant cells on FNA in which no residual tumour was found in fibrotic lymph nodes after neoadjuvant therapy (cytology and histology confirmed on review) ThinPrep detected nodal metastasis with an overall sensitivity of 77.5%, specificity of 100%, PPV of 100% and NPV of 53.7%. Diagnostic accuracy was 82.2%. There was no difference in Bloom–Richardson grade or the number or size of metastases between tumours with true‐positive and false‐negative cytology. Sampling error was the sole factor contributing to cyto‐histological discrepancy. Conclusions: ThinPrep is a good alternative to the conventional smear for cytological assessment of axillary lymph node status in patients with invasive breast carcinoma, particularly when specimens are collected at remote sites or when cytologists are not available for assistance during FNA.  相似文献

In a group of 400 nephrotic patients, both adults and children, the histological picture seen on renal biopsy, the selectivity of differential protein clearances, and the response to corticosteroid therapy where applied were studied. The only discernible difference was that of the relative incidence of underlying renal disease; in particular, the much greater incidence of “minimal change” lesions and the near absence of glomerular disease secondary to systemic disorders in children. Highly selective differential protein clearances were strongly associated with response to steroids within eight weeks, and this depended on the relation between this type of protein clearance and the minimal change lesion, which was the only histological appearance associated with complete response to corticosteroid therapy within eight weeks. Neither renal biopsy nor studies of proteinuria allowed prediction of which responding patients would subsequently relapse.Studies of differential protein clearances allow the paediatrician to avoid renal biopsy with safety in nephrotic children aged 1 to 5 years, but cannot distinguish any given renal disease with certainty. Generalized diseases affecting the kidney are usually associated with poorly selective differential protein clearances. Within all groups the most severe changes were usually associated with the least selective differential protein clearances, and vice versa.  相似文献

Serum aluminium concentrations and biopsy specimens of bone were examined in 56 patients with end stage chronic renal failure receiving maintenance haemodialysis. Deposits of aluminium in bone specimens were often associated with low bone formation with or without osteomalacia. Serum aluminium concentrations of greater than 3.7 mumol/l (10 micrograms/100 ml) indicated a high probability of deposits of aluminium in bone specimens, although high serum concentrations did not predict the type of renal bone disease. Biopsy of the bone is the best method of detecting aluminium intoxication of bone. A serum aluminium concentration of 3.7 mumol/l should be the threshold beyond which bone biopsy should be performed to confirm an overload of aluminium and identify histological bone changes induced by aluminium.  相似文献

With the aim of evaluating the reliability of morning urine collection, compared to the overnight period, in the assessment of microalbuminuria, we measured albumin and creatinine concentration in overnight and morning urine of 125 diabetic outpatients. The overnight albumin excretion rate resulted in relation to morning albumin concentration and morning albumin/creatinine ratio. The sensitivity of this method of urine collection, compared to the overnight sample, was 55.5%, the specificity 96.6% and the predictive value 43% using, as a measure, the albumin concentration. These values improved by correcting albumin for creatinine concentration. Concerning high risk albuminuria (overnight excretion rate greater than 30 micrograms/min), we found a sensitivity and predictive value of the first morning collection highly improved by the albumin/creatinine ratio. It is concluded that the first morning urine collection can be used in the diagnosis of microalbuminuria in diabetic patients, especially when we calculate the albumin/creatinine ratio. This simple and reliable method allows the identification of microalbuminuric subjects and of the patients at risk to develop clinical nephropathy with a good sensitivity.  相似文献

Background. Treatment of antibiotic-resistant Helicobacter pylori should be based on bacterial sensitivity testing that requires the ability to isolate the bacterium from gastric mucosal biopsies. The aim of this study was to determine whether the yield for detecting H. pylori infection by culture is reduced by immersion of biopsy forceps in formalin prior to obtaining the specimen.
Materials and Methods. Gastric antral mucosal biopsies (100 specimens) from 50 patients were obtained for culture of H. pylori. An antral biopsy was taken for culture, and with the same forceps a biopsy was taken for histological examination. The biopsy specimen was removed by shaking, whereas the forceps was immersed in 10% buffered formalin for the histological investigation. The forceps was then used without rinsing to obtain a second specimen for culture from an area adjacent to the first site. H. pylori status was determined by histological assessment with the Genta stain and a rapid urease test.
Results. Fifty patients with H. pylori infection documented by histological inquiry and positive rapid urease testing entered the study; 29 had duodenal ulcers, 5 had gastric ulcers, 1 had mucosal associated lymphoid tissue (MALT) lymphoma, and 15 were without ulcer disease. The results of culture both before and after immersion in formalin were identical. One patient had both cultures negative; the sensitivity of culture for detection of H. pylori infection was 98% (95% confidence interval =93%-100%).
Conclusion. Preimmersion of biopsy forceps in formalin does not adversely affect the ability to culture H. pylori.  相似文献

We examined the accuracy of pulmonary cytology in 224 consecutive patients being evaluated for lung cancer. The diagnostic yeild of specimens obtained by various methods, including flexible fiber optic bronchoscopy (FFB), was compared. Among 69 patients with lung cancer, a cytologic diagnosis was made in 87%, including 73% with peripheral tumors. Prebronchoscopy sputa were positive in 50%, bronchial washings in 63%, postbronchoscopy sputa in 82% and bronchial brushings in 59% of the patients. In only one patient was the bronchial brush specimen the only positive cytologic specimen. Normal FFB and small cell undifferentiated cancer were found with increased frequency (P less than 0.05) among the nine patients (13%) with false-negative cytology. Among 155 patients with nonmalignant lung disease, 16 (10%) had false-positive specimens; this finding was significantly related (P less than 0.05) to necrotizing pneumonia in 13 of the 16 patients (81%). The overall diagnostic accuracy of cytology showed 87% sensitivity and 90% specificity, and the predictive value of a positive specimen was 79%. In the absence of necrotizing pneumonia these values exceeded 95%.  相似文献

OBJECTIVE: To evaluate whether the protein:creatinine ratio in spot morning urine samples is a reliable indicator of 24 hour urinary protein excretion and predicts the rate of decline of glomerular filtration rate and progression to end stage renal failure in non-diabetic patients with chronic nephropathy. DESIGN: Cross sectional correlation between the ratio and urinary protein excretion rate. Univariate and multivariate analysis of baseline predictors, including the ratio and 24 hour urinary protein, of decline in glomerular filtration rate and end stage renal failure in the long term. SETTING: Research centre in Italy. SUBJECTS: 177 non-diabetic outpatients with chronic renal disease screened for participation in the ramipril efficacy in nephropathy study. MAIN OUTCOME MEASURES: Rate of decline in filtration rate evaluated by repeated measurements of unlabelled iohexol plasma clearance and rate of progression to renal failure. RESULTS: Protein:creatinine ratio was significantly correlated with absolute and log transformed 24 hour urinary protein values (P = 0.0001 and P < 0.0001, respectively.) Ratios also had high predictive value for rate of decline of the glomerular filtration rate (univariate P = 0.0003, multivariate P = 0.004) and end stage renal failure (P = 0.002 and P = 0.04). Baseline protein:creatinine ratios and rate of decline of the glomerular filtration rate were also significantly correlated (P < 0.0005). In the lowest third of the protein:creatinine ratio (< 1.7) there was 3% renal failure compared with 21.2% in the highest third (> 2.7) (P < 0.05). CONCLUSIONS: Protein:creatinine ratio in spot morning urine samples is a precise indicator of proteinuria and a reliable predictor of progression of disease in non-diabetic patients with chronic nephropathies and represents a simple and inexpensive procedure in establishing severity of renal disease and prognosis.  相似文献

The protein creatinine index in early morning and random urine specimens was compared with the 24 hour urinary excretion of protein in normal subjects and outpatients with abnormal proteinuria. A protein creatinine index (defined as (mg protein/1 divided by creatinine mmol/1) times 10) below 125 in a random specimen excluded abnormal proteinuria, whereas an index of more than 136 indicated the presence of pathological proteinuria. The index for random specimens provided a useful semiquantitative assessment of the 24 hour excretion of protein (mg protein/24 hours), but the index for early morning specimens was less reliable. Errors with Albustix were partly due to intra and inter observer variations in the interpretation of the colour formed when compared with the chart provided. It is proposed that the protein creatinine index on random urine samples should be used to supplement dipsticks in screening for proteinuria in cases where misclassification would be serious.  相似文献

OBJECTIVE: To evaluate the performance of reagent test strips in screening pregnant women for asymptomatic bacteriuria at their first visit to an antenatal clinic. DESIGN: Prospective case series. SETTING: Antenatal clinic of a large inner city maternity hospital. SUBJECTS: All women attending for their first antenatal clinic. Patients taking antibiotics for any reason and those with urinary tract symptoms were excluded. INTERVENTION: A midstream urine specimen was divided; half was sent for microscopy and formal bacteriological culture and the other half was tested with a commercial reagent strip test for the presence of blood, protein, nitrite, and leucocyte esterase. MAIN OUTCOME MEASURES: Sensitivity, specificity, and positive and negative predictive values of the reagent strips in diagnosing asymptomatic bacteriuria (defined as 10(5) colony forming units/ml urine). RESULTS: Sensitivity was low, with a maximum of 33% when all four tests were used in combination. Specificity was high, with typical values of 99% or more. Positive predictive value reached a maximum of 69% and negative predictive value was typically 95% or more. CONCLUSION: Urine reagent strips are not sufficiently sensitive to be of use in the screening for asymptomatic bacteriuria and therefore many patients would be missed. In view of the potentially serious sequelae of this condition in pregnant women we recommend that formal bacteriological investigation remain the investigation of choice in this group of patients.  相似文献

Ginseng preparations contain high concentrations of germanium (Ge), which was reported to contribute to diuretic resistance or renal failure. However, Ge content in ginseng and the influence on renal functions remain unclear. Forty rats were randomly divided into control group, low, moderate, and high Ge ginseng-treated group and observed for 25 days. Daily urine, renal functions, and serum and urine electrolytics were measured. Ge retention in the organs and renal histological changes were also evaluated. Ge content ranged from 0.007 to 0.450 µg/g in various ginseng samples. Four groups showed no difference in the daily urine output, glomerular filtration rate, urinary electrolytes excretions, 24 h-urine protein, as well as plasma and urine urea nitrogen, creatinine, osmotic pressure, and pH values. Ge did not cause any renal pathological effects in this study. No Na and water retention was detected in the ginseng-treated groups. Ge retention in various organs was found highest in spleen, followed by the kidney, liver, lung, stomach, heart, and pancreas. The total Ge contents in various ginsengs were low, and ginseng treatment did not affect renal functions or cause renal histological changes.  相似文献

Background

Diagnosis followed by effective treatment of tuberculosis (TB) reduces transmission and saves lives in persons living with HIV (PLHIV). Sputum smear microscopy is widely used for diagnosis, despite limited sensitivity in PLHIV. Evidence is needed to determine the optimal diagnostic approach for these patients.

Methods

From May 2011 through June 2012, we recruited PLHIV from 15 HIV treatment centers in western Kenya. We collected up to three sputum specimens for Ziehl-Neelsen (ZN) and fluorescence microscopy (FM), GeneXpert MTB/RIF (Xpert), and culture, regardless of symptoms. We calculated the incremental yield of each test, stratifying results by CD4 cell count and specimen type; data were analyzed to account for complex sampling.

Results

From 778 enrolled patients, we identified 88 (11.3%) laboratory-confirmed TB cases. Of the 74 cases who submitted 2 specimens for microscopy and Xpert testing, ZN microscopy identified 25 (33.6%); Xpert identified those plus an additional 18 (incremental yield = 24.4%). Xpert testing of spot specimens identified 48 (57.0%) of 84 cases; whereas Xpert testing of morning specimens identified 50 (66.0%) of 76 cases. Two Xpert tests detected 22/24 (92.0%) TB cases with CD4 counts <100 cells/μL and 30/45 (67.0%) of cases with CD4 counts ≥100 cells/μl.

Conclusions

In PLHIV, Xpert substantially increased diagnostic yield compared to smear microscopy and had the highest yield when used to test morning specimens and specimens from PLHIV with CD4 count <100 cells/μL. TB programs unable to replace smear microscopy with Xpert for all symptomatic PLHIV should consider targeted replacement and using morning specimens.  相似文献

Between 1978 and 1983, 317 diagnostic fine needle aspirations (FNA) were procured at Indiana University by the Cytology, Radiology or Gynecology services for initial evaluation or follow-up of proven gynecologic malignancies. The primary sites of the neoplasms included the cervix, uterus, ovary, vagina and vulva. Totals of 199 samples were procured from superficial sites, including parametrium, vagina, subcutaneous tissue and superficial lymph nodes, and 118 were obtained from deep soft tissues, abdominal organs, pelvis and deep lymph nodes. Of the FNA specimens, 146 (46%) were cytologically diagnosed as malignant and 171 (54%) were reported as benign. Of the specimens initially given negative diagnoses, 35 (11%) were inadequate samples. No complications occurred as a result of FNA biopsy. All cases were reclassified using strict criteria for an inadequate specimen. After review, 79 biopsies were considered either scant (22%) or inappropriate (0.03%) for the target lesion. Scant specimens were obtained more often in superficial than in deep sites. No significant differences were found in the false-negative rate between superficial and deep sites; all false positives were from superficial sites. The use of strict criteria for adequacy of a sample (two groups of appropriate cells on two separate slides) yielded a specificity of 95%, an increased sensitivity from 73% to 91%, a predictive value for a positive result of 98% and a predictive value for a negative result of 84%. Use of strict criteria for specimen adequacy served to reemphasize two points regarding negative FNA results: that rebiopsy should be suggested and that on-site assessment of the specimen adequacy should be made during the aspiration.  相似文献
